Abstract
The invention relates to a pregnant woman physiological nursing device based on a parallel topological structure, which comprises a lying plate, wherein a recovery training device is arranged at the rear end of the lying plate, an auxiliary device is arranged in the middle of the lying plate, the recovery training device comprises training supports arranged on the lying plate, stepping training mechanisms are symmetrically arranged on the left side and the right side of each training support, and a pulling matching mechanism is arranged on each stepping training mechanism. Detailed Description
The embodiments of the invention will be described in detail below with reference to the drawings, but the invention can be implemented in many different ways as defined and covered by the claims.
As shown in fig. 1 to 5, the pregnant woman physiological nursing device based on the parallel topological structure comprises a lying plate 1, wherein a recovery training device 2 is arranged at the rear end of the lying plate 1, and an auxiliary device 3 is arranged in the middle of the lying plate 1.
The tension chain 24 comprises a tension frame 241 arranged on the outer wall of the training installation frame 221, a tension hole is formed in the tension frame 241, a tension hook 242 is arranged in the tension hole, one end, located on the inner side of the tension hole, of the tension hook 242 is connected with a tension training spring 243, and the tension training spring 243 is arranged on the outer wall of the training installation frame 221.
The connecting buckle 25 comprises a connecting rod 251 arranged on the side wall of the training force transmission column 222 through a pin shaft, a connecting ring 252 is arranged on the connecting rod 251, a connecting spring 253 is arranged on the side wall of the connecting rod 251, the connecting spring 253 is installed on a connecting plate 254, the connecting plate 254 is arranged on the training force transmission column 222, a clamping frame 255 is arranged at the lower end of the connecting plate 254 through a pin shaft, a limiting frame 256 for limiting the movement of the clamping frame 255 is arranged on the connecting plate 254, and the connecting ring 252 which does not need to be operated is limited by manually controlling the clamping frame 255.
The tension chain 24 and the connecting buckle 25 are matched with each other for use, the tension chain 24 is selected to be suitable for being connected with the connecting buckle 25 according to the actual situation of a pregnant woman, the tension hook 242 is manually hung into the connecting ring 252, and tension training springs 243 with different numbers are selected to control the exercise force.
The pregnant woman lies on the lying board 1, steps on the training pedal 223 with both feet, and forcibly presses the training pedal 223 to exercise the legs.
The pulling matching mechanism 23 comprises a guide roller 231 arranged at the rear end of the training dowel 222, an adjusting roller 232 and a guide roller 233 are arranged at the upper end of the training installation frame 221, a tension support frame 234 is installed on the lying plate 1, a guide hole is formed in the tension support frame 234, a guide pipe 235 is arranged in the guide hole, a tension rope 236 is connected to the rear end of the training dowel 222, the tension rope 236 sequentially passes through the guide roller 231, the adjusting roller 232, the guide roller 233 and the guide pipe 235 from back to front, and the front end of the tension rope 236 is connected with a tension ring 237.
The adjusting roller 232 comprises a spring limiting column installed on the training installation frame 221, a limiting adjusting frame is installed at the upper end of the spring limiting column, and the adjusting roller 232 is arranged between the inner walls of the limiting adjusting frame through a bearing.
The pregnant woman pulls the tension ring 237 with both hands, and the training dowel 222 is controlled by the tension rope 236 to move and adjust, so that the effect of arm exercise is achieved.
Auxiliary device 3 is including setting up the operation groove on service creeper 1, operation parcel frame 31 is installed to service creeper 1's lower extreme, evenly be provided with parallel mechanism 32 on the operation parcel frame 31, driven buffer board 33 is installed to parallel mechanism 32's upper end, there is buffer beam 34 through hinged joint between the inner wall in driven buffer board 33 and operation groove, and the parcel has rubber buffer cover 35 between driven buffer board 33 and the service creeper 1, auxiliary device 3 can be according to the buttock of the supplementary pregnant woman of direction as the direction of force motion hard in the pregnant woman exercise process, thereby alleviate the atress of pregnant woman waist in the motion, guarantee can not receive the injury because of hard greatly in the motion.
The parallel mechanism 32 comprises a static platform 321 installed on the operation wrapping frame 31, four electric push rods 322 are evenly arranged on the static platform 321 along the circumferential direction of the static platform through pin shafts, the top ends of the electric push rods 322 are installed on the electric push rods 322 through ball hinges, the static platform 321, the pin shafts, the four electric push rods 322, the ball hinges and the electric push rods 322 form a 4-RPU parallel structure, the static platform 321 is connected with the electric push rods 322 through the pin shafts to form an R pair, the electric push rods 322 form a P pair when stretching, and the electric push rods 322 are connected with the movable platform 433 through the ball hinges to form the U pair.
The buttocks of the pregnant woman are positioned on the rubber buffer cover 35, the parallel mechanism 32 and the buffer rod 34 are mutually matched to move to play a role in guiding and damping the driven buffer plate 33, and the parallel mechanism 32 is matched with the stress direction of the buttocks of the pregnant woman to adjust in the movement of the pregnant woman, so that the stress of the waist of the pregnant woman in the movement is reduced, and the pregnant woman is guaranteed not to be injured due to overlarge force in the movement.
During nursing:
the training force is selected, the tension chain 24 and the connecting buckle 25 are matched with each other for use, the proper tension chain 24 is selected to be connected with the connecting buckle 25 according to the actual situation of the pregnant woman, the tension hook 242 is manually hung in the connecting ring 252, and the tension training springs 243 with different quantities are selected to control the exercise force.
During leg training, a pregnant woman lies on the lying plate 1, steps on the training pedal 223 with both feet, and forcibly presses the training pedal 223 to exercise the legs.
When the arm is trained, the pregnant woman pulls the tension ring 237 with both hands, and the training dowel 222 is controlled by the tension rope 236 to move and adjust, so that the effect of arm exercise is achieved.
When taking exercise, the pregnant woman lies on the lying board 1, the two feet are pedaled on the training pedal 223, the two hands pull the tension ring 237, the hands and the legs coordinate to exert force, thereby driving the body to twist, the buttocks of the pregnant woman is positioned on the rubber buffer cover 35, the parallel mechanism 32 and the buffer rod 34 are mutually matched to move to play the role of guiding and damping on the driven buffer board 33, the pregnant woman adjusts the stress direction of the parallel mechanism 32 matched with the buttocks of the pregnant woman in the movement, thereby reducing the stress of the waist of the pregnant woman in the movement, and ensuring that the pregnant woman cannot be injured due to over-force in the movement
